From Transaction Security to Decision Security

For years, payment innovation focused primarily on protecting the transaction itself. Encryption, authentication methods, and account verification systems became essential components of digital commerce.

That foundation remains important.

However, a broader shift is emerging. Future payment ecosystems are likely to focus not only on securing transactions but also on helping users make safer decisions before a payment occurs.

This concept can be described as decision security. Instead of reacting to risks after they appear, platforms may increasingly provide guidance that helps users identify concerns early in the process.

In this vision, safety becomes an active experience rather than a background feature.
